Alex Sheen, Founder of because I said I would, Visits MCJDC for Third Time to Speak with Detained Youth

Medina County Juvenile Detention Center (MCJDC) became the first pilot site for a 12-week because I said I would program tailored specifically for detained youth earlier this year. The curriculum is centered around the simple concept behind the non-profit: Make a promise and follow through with it. because I said I would founder, Alex Sheen, made his third visit to the facility November 7 to reiterate that message in person with the youth.
